SilvaGrid’s temperate trees hub groups true woody phanerophytes native to mid-latitude climates with distinct seasonal change. This includes deciduous hardwoods, temperate broadleaf evergreens and tree-form conifers adapted to warm growing seasons, winter cold, frost or dormancy.

Use this hub to compare four-season canopy options for gardens, public landscapes, shelter planting, urban forestry and ecological restoration. Filter by WGSRPD native range to identify candidate trees, then check local hardiness, soil volume, moisture, root space, wind exposure and long-term maintenance requirements.

Data Profile: Temperate Trees

  • Taxonomic Scale: 5,002 taxa spanning 396 genera and 101 families. (Includes 3,791 base species and 1,211 natural variants/hybrids).
  • Dominant Families: Rosaceae (23%), Salicaceae (9%), Ericaceae (8%).
  • Dominant Genera: Rhododendron (7%), Salix (7%), Crataegus (6%).
